[TOC]
1.查看repository中的image
假设集群上docker 私有仓库做到了master节点,172.16.10.10:5000。
获取已有image
私有仓库目前已有images如下:
1 | $curl http://172.16.10.10:5000/v2/_catalog|python2 -m json.tool |
获取制定image的所有版本号
如果想要查看对应的images拥有哪些版本, 例如paddlepaddle/paddle 这个镜像的版本
1 | $curl http://172.16.10.10:5000/v2/paddlepaddle/paddle/tags/list|python2 -m json.tool |
只需要修改中间对应的名字即可
2.上传和下载image
下面简单介绍一下如何从私有仓库下载和上传镜像。
找到对应的镜像和版本之后,执行
1 | $docker pull 172.16.10.10:5000/paddlepaddle/paddle:0.10.0 #下载images |